GetHashFromFile, fonction
Génère un hachage sur le contenu du fichier spécifié.
Cette fonction est déconseillée dans le .NET Framework version 4. Utilisez à la place la méthode ICLRStrongName::GetHashFromFile.
HRESULT GetHashFromFile (
[in] LPCSTR szFilePath,
[in, out] unsigned int *piHashAlg,
[out] BYTE *pbHash,
[in] DWORD cchHash,
[out] DWORD *pchHash
);
Paramètres
szFilePath
[in] Nom du fichier à hacher.piHashAlg
[in, out] Algorithme à utiliser lors de la génération du hachage. Les algorithmes valides sont ceux définis par le CryptoAPI Win32. Si piHashAlg a la valeur 0, l'algorithme par défaut CALG_SHA-1 est utilisé.pbHash
[out] Tableau d'octets contenant le hachage généré.cchHash
[in] Taille maximale de la mémoire tampon vers laquelle pointe pbHash.pchHash
[out] Taille en octets de pbHash retourné.
Notes
Cette fonction est similaire à GetHashFromFileW, si ce n'est que la spécification de nom de fichier est au format ANSI au lieu d'Unicode.
Configuration requise
Plateformes : consultez Configuration requise du .NET Framework.
En-tête : StrongName.h
Bibliothèque : incluse en tant que ressource dans MsCorEE.dll
Versions du .NET Framework : 4, 3.5 SP1, 3.5, 3.0 SP1, 3.0, 2.0 SP1, 2.0
Voir aussi
Référence
Autres ressources
Méthode ICLRStrongName::GetHashFromFile
Méthode ICLRStrongName::GetHashFromFileW
Historique des modifications
Date |
Historique |
Motif |
---|---|---|
Juillet 2010 |
Lien ajouté à l'alternative recommandée. |
Améliorations apportées aux informations. |